DIY Clothesline

This super simple DIY clothesline is our newest playroom staple! Use clothes pins to hang a variety of different items, such as felt shapes, baby socks, and the 'Christmas Light' clothes pins we found at our local Dollarama.



Materials:

  • wood dowels, 2

  • piece of scrap wood; I used a leftover piece of baseboard

  • drill & bit

  • hot glue gun & glue

  • string or yarn

  • measuring tape/ruler & pencil


How To:


1. Mark 1" on both top sides of the wood and drill a hole. Be sure not to drill all the way through!



2. Check that your dowels fit snuggly in the holes. Fill with glue and insert dowels. Let cool.



3. Attach your yarn or string! You can make a criss-cross pattern like I did, or one simple & straight across line.


Tie or glue on, whichever your preference. I did a bit of both to ensure the string wouldn't come off or slide around.















4. PLAY! All clothesline activities are so great for fine motor work. Watch your littles concentrate and really use those small hand muscles & hand-eye coordination to squeeze the clothespin and attach the items.




Happy playing & hanging!
